Police Unsure Why Son Struck Father with Five-Pound Dumbbell

Police haven't been able to find the teenager who allegedly struck his father with a weight Sunday.

Shorewood police are currently investigating why a teenager struck his father with a five-pound dumbbell Sunday.

According to the police report, the father was transported to Columbia St. Mary’s due to injuries after his son hit him with a five-pound weight at their home in the 4000 block of North Downer Avenue. Police said it is still unclear what the circumstances were around the battery.

Police tried to track down the juvenile at Shorewood Intermediate School Monday morning, but were unable to locate him.
